Not cutting up DS’ grapes?

255 replies

moryn · 14/04/2026 16:18

I was approached by a member of staff at pick up today, to tell me that the kitchen staff expressed concerns that DS’ grapes were whole and not cut up.

He’s 7.5. He chews properly, sits still to eat etc.

I was under the impression that the guidance is for children aged 5 and below.

AIBU here?

Was it cut in half the right way? I once, on a play date, saw a woman cut grapes in half the wrong way. I kindly pointed out that it should be length ways as across the middle still leaves the grape the same size and shape as a child’s windpipe. She had no idea!
